    This is kind of a two part question. First would a 250w MH with T5 ho sups be to much for a 29 gal reef? Then second, i had a reef tank with bryopsis ( i think ) on the rocks, but they have been dry for over 6 months, should i bleach them still?

    I have a 150w halide over my 29g. I have SPS in there. 250w would be too much IMO and i think a 150w is great.

    MH is alot better IMO..Although with heat thats another thing. With my tank, if i leave the heater on during my MH is on, the heat will go up to 85.7 no problem. If I shut off the heater about an hour before the MH comes on. The heat only gets up to 82.3. I have no fans, but definitly go with MH. But do a 150w
